What is Chicken Karahi?
Chicken Karahi (or Kadai Chicken) is a spicy tomato-based curry made with chicken, tomatoes, ginger, garlic, green chilies, and aromatic spices. It gets its name from the ‘karahi’, a traditional wok-style pan used for cooking this sizzling dish.
Ingredients You'll Need
Serves 4 | Cooking time: ~35 minutes
- 500g bone-in chicken (cut into medium pieces)
- 4 medium ripe tomatoes (chopped or blended)
- 1 medium onion (finely sliced – optional)
- 1 tbsp ginger paste
- 1 tbsp garlic paste
- 3–4 green chilies (slit or chopped)
- 1 tsp red chili powder (adjust to taste)
- 1 tsp crushed black pepper
- 1 tsp coriander powder
- 1/2 tsp turmeric powder
- 1 tsp cumin seeds
- Salt to taste
- 4–5 tbsp cooking oil or ghee
- Fresh coriander (for garnish)
- Ginger julienne (for garnish)
Step-by-Step Cooking Instructions
Step 1: Heat Oil & Add Chicke
- In a karahi or deep pan, heat oil on medium flame.
- Add chicken pieces and sauté for 6–8 minutes until lightly golden.
Step 2: Add Ginger & Garlic Paste
- Stir in ginger and garlic paste, cook for 2 minutes until the raw smell disappears.
Step 3: Add Tomatoes & Spices
- Add blended/chopped tomatoes, red chili powder, turmeric, coriander, salt, and cumin.
- Cook uncovered on medium heat for 10–12 minutes until oil separates.
Step 4: Add Green Chilies & Simmer
- Add chopped green chilies and black pepper.
- Cover and cook on low flame for 10 more minutes until chicken is tender.
Step 5: Final Touch
- Garnish with julienned ginger and chopped coriander.
- Serve hot with naan, roti, or steamed rice.
Tips for Best Results
- Use fresh tomatoes, not canned, for an authentic flavor.
- Cook until oil separates for restaurant-style aroma and texture.
- Adjust spice levels as per your taste — make it milder or extra spicy!
Serving Suggestions
- Pair with butter naan, garlic naan, or steamed basmati rice
- Add a side of raita (yogurt dip) or fresh salad for a complete meal
